Re: Stored/Scrapped Aircraft??
F-15A F-4 & F-111 are in the memorial park with the replica Spitfire and are not visible from outside that I'm aware of.
The latest copy of Wrecks and Relics which I've now had time to look at says the F-15B was in use as an instructional BDRF airframe but hadn't been noted since 2014 and is now deleted from their listing. Can't find anything on it anywhere else. Could still be there, may have been scrapped. I suspect, in any case, it was hangared during its tenure.
